The postcode BH31 6NX is located in Dorset It was introduced in September 1991 and is an active postcode. BH31 6NX is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

BH31 6NX is one of the less de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 7.3 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of BH31 6NX as Suburbanites > Semi-detached suburbia > White suburban communities.

The closest road name to BH31 6NX is The Curlews which is centered 71 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Claylake Drive and is 143 m away.

The closest primary school to BH31 6NX (for ages 11 and under) is St Ives Primary & Nursery School.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Ringwood School Academy. The last OFSTED inspection on March 30, 2017 rated this school as Good

The local pub for residents of BH31 6NX is THE SWANS and is 497 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on March 16, 2022. The nearest takeaway food is available from Harlees Fish and Chips and is 478 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Very Good on January 22, 2020.

Residents reported an average download speed of 39 Mbps and an average upload speed of 9.5 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 1.5 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for BH31 6NX is covered by the Dorset police force association and Dorset is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
